> There are two reasons for orphaning:
> 1) I don't use it anymore. I have switched to a DVCS
> 2) Upstream will sell cvsnt (community edition as they call it) in the future.
> This is possible in compliance with the GPL. For a possible future maintainer,
> there is a free and anonymous CVS read access, but this can be terminated
> without further notice at any time.
> 
> The package suffers a critical bug and should be updated or even better
> removed from Debian.

In light of 2) we should rather remove it than continuing to include
it in Squeeze. It also has hardly any users in popcon.
